Shipment Analytics for Small Businesses: The 10 KPIs Worth Tracking Weekly
Track 10 weekly shipment KPIs that reveal shipping cost, speed, and failures without enterprise BI complexity.
Small business shipping teams do not need enterprise-grade business intelligence to make better decisions. They do need a simple weekly view of parcel performance, cost, and failure points so they can act before margins erode or customers churn. That is the practical middle ground this guide is built for: a lightweight KPI framework for shipping analytics that helps SMBs monitor the essentials without building a data warehouse. Why Weekly Shipment Analytics Beats Occasional Reporting
Weekly rhythm matches the speed of shipping operations
Shipping is not a quarterly planning function; it is a live operational process that changes every day. Carrier delays, weather disruptions, service-level changes, overselling, and warehouse errors can all affect parcels within hours, not months. A weekly review is frequent enough to catch drift, but not so frequent that teams drown in noise. For many SMBs, a Monday morning dashboard with last week’s numbers is the ideal balance between urgency and manageability.
This cadence also aligns well with how fulfillment teams work. Picking, packing, label generation, handoff, transit, and delivery all generate measurable signals, but the right action often depends on looking at patterns rather than isolated incidents. A one-day spike in late deliveries may be a fluke; three consecutive weeks of declining on-time performance is a structural problem. That is why weekly shipment KPIs are more useful than occasional reports that arrive after the business has already absorbed the damage.

What SMBs should optimize for first
Most small businesses do not have the luxury of chasing every metric. The priority should be metrics that directly affect cash flow and customer satisfaction. That usually means cost per shipment, on-time delivery rate, delivery exceptions, order accuracy, transit speed, and damage or return frequency. Once those are stable, you can layer in more diagnostic metrics such as label creation lead time or carrier scan compliance.
Think of the weekly dashboard as a control panel, not a report card. The goal is not to admire numbers; it is to make faster decisions about packaging, carrier selection, service level mix, fulfillment quality, and customer communication. If your dashboard does not help you change one of those levers, it is too complicated for an SMB environment.
The 10 Shipment KPIs Worth Tracking Weekly
1. Cost per shipment
Cost per shipment is the simplest and most important KPI for small business logistics because it connects shipping activity to margin. Include postage, surcharges, packaging, pick-and-pack labor if possible, insurance, and any special handling fees. The formula is straightforward: total shipping-related cost divided by total shipped orders. Watching this weekly helps you see whether zone mix, dimensional weight, carrier surcharges, or packaging changes are pushing costs upward.
For example, a merchant shipping 1,200 parcels a week may discover that average cost per shipment rose from $8.40 to $9.10 after switching packaging. That 70-cent change can wipe out margin quickly at scale. If the increase came from dimensional weight, the fix might be carton right-sizing. If it came from residential surcharges, the fix might be changing service rules at checkout or improving address verification.
2. On-time delivery rate
On-time delivery rate measures the percentage of shipments delivered on or before the promised date. It is one of the strongest proxies for customer experience because customers usually remember delay more than transit details. Weekly tracking helps you identify whether delays are carrier-specific, lane-specific, or caused by internal handoff problems. A good dashboard should compare actual delivery performance against the promise made at checkout, not just against the carrier’s published estimate.
This metric matters even more if you sell on marketplaces, where service-level failures can impact visibility and account health. If your on-time delivery rate declines, check whether the issue is coming from late dispatch, inaccurate delivery estimates, or a carrier service that has degraded in certain zones. 3. Order accuracy rate
Order accuracy measures the percentage of orders shipped correctly with the right item, quantity, and label. This KPI is a direct reflection of your pick-pack process, inventory synchronization, and exception handling. Errors here create expensive downstream effects: reships, refunds, support tickets, and customer distrust. Because of that, order accuracy should be reviewed weekly even by small teams with low volumes.
A practical SMB target is to break this KPI into error types rather than just one aggregate number. Track wrong item, wrong quantity, wrong address, and missing item separately. That way, you know whether the issue is warehouse training, inventory control, or address validation. 4. Average transit time
Average transit time shows how long parcels spend in the carrier network from shipment to delivery. Unlike on-time delivery rate, which measures service promises, transit time reveals actual shipping speed. It is valuable for spotting slow lanes, underperforming services, and seasonal congestion. Weekly trends also help you determine whether a carrier is slowing down in a way that will eventually affect customer satisfaction and repeat purchase behavior.
To make this KPI actionable, segment it by service, region, and shipping origin. A two-day service might average two days in one zone and four days in another, which means your routing rules should vary by geography. This is particularly important for SMBs that ship from one fulfillment site to multiple customer regions. 5. Delivery exception rate
Delivery exception rate measures the percentage of shipments that encounter a carrier issue such as address problem, weather delay, damaged package, failed delivery attempt, or scan anomaly. This is one of the best early-warning metrics in shipping analytics because exceptions often precede customer service contacts and refunds. Weekly exception tracking helps you determine whether the problem is operational, carrier-related, or customer-data related.
Do not treat all exceptions equally. A weather delay is not the same as a bad address or a label that never scanned. If your exception rate spikes, segment the causes and map them to corrective actions. Bad address issues can be reduced with checkout validation; damage issues can be reduced with packaging changes; scan issues may require carrier escalation or process timing adjustments.
6. Shipping label creation lead time
This KPI measures the time between order placement and label creation. It matters because label speed is often the earliest sign of fulfillment bottlenecks. If orders are being paid for quickly but labels are created late, your business may be overpromising dispatch speed or struggling with batch processing. The metric is especially useful for SMBs that promise same-day or next-day processing.
Review lead time by hour of order, channel, and warehouse shift. If labels are consistently delayed for marketplace orders but not DTC orders, the issue may be integration latency or workflow complexity. Improving this metric can also improve customer trust because quick label creation usually correlates with better status visibility and fewer “where is my order?” tickets.
7. Scan compliance rate
Scan compliance rate measures the percentage of parcels that receive all expected carrier scans, such as acceptance, in-transit, out-for-delivery, and delivered. This KPI is often ignored by small businesses, but it is crucial for tracking integrity. If scans are missing, your customer service team loses visibility and your automated notifications become less reliable. A low scan compliance rate can make a perfectly healthy shipment appear late or lost.
Weekly scan compliance also helps you identify handoff problems. If packages leave your facility without a proper acceptance scan, you may have proof-of-ship issues during disputes. If final delivery scans are missing, you may need a carrier service review. Small businesses that rely on automatic tracking updates should treat this as a core parcel performance metric, not a technical detail.
8. First attempt delivery success rate
This KPI tells you what percentage of parcels are delivered successfully on the first attempt. It is especially important for residential delivery, high-value items, and goods requiring signature or special access. Low first-attempt success often means address quality problems, poor delivery instructions, or customer availability issues. It also drives avoidable cost through redelivery attempts and customer support.
To improve this metric, test checkout address validation, delivery note prompts, and carrier service selection. If your product mix includes items that often require a person to receive the package, consider whether your shipping promises are realistic. 9. Return rate due to shipping issues
Not all returns are product-related. Some happen because the package arrived too late, was damaged, or could not be delivered. Tracking shipping-related returns separately from normal returns is essential because it tells you whether operations are creating avoidable churn. In a weekly dashboard, this KPI should be expressed as a share of shipped orders and segmented by reason code.
If shipping-related returns rise, check packaging, carrier handling, zone mix, and communication quality. A return due to a damaged box is a fulfillment issue, not a merchandising issue. A return due to late arrival may point to unrealistic promises at checkout. In both cases, this KPI helps leadership focus on process fixes rather than blaming the wrong team.
10. Delivery rate by service level
Delivery rate by service level measures how often each shipping option actually arrives successfully within expectation. This is the metric that helps you decide whether to keep, drop, or reroute specific carrier services. It is more useful than raw carrier reports because it reflects the real customer experience for your business mix, not the carrier’s average across all shippers.
Weekly service-level analysis often reveals hidden inefficiencies. A premium service may be very reliable but too expensive for most orders. A economy service may be cheap but produce too many exceptions. The goal is not to use one carrier everywhere, but to create a shipping policy that matches order value, delivery promise, and customer expectations.
How to Build a Weekly Dashboard Without Enterprise BI
Step 1: Define one source of truth
Before building any dashboard, decide which system owns each data element. Orders may live in your ecommerce platform, labels in your shipping platform, and delivery events in your carrier or tracking tool. If multiple systems disagree on status, the dashboard becomes controversial instead of useful. A simple weekly process should clearly define which source is authoritative for shipment date, delivery date, and exceptions.
Small businesses often overcomplicate this step because they try to reconcile everything in real time. Instead, choose a weekly cutoff and a fixed data extraction date. That way, every Monday report compares like with like, and teams can trust the trend line. This is the same logic behind disciplined BI programs: consistent data definitions matter more than fancy visualization.
Step 2: Use a compact metric set
Ten KPIs are usually enough for SMB shipping management. More than that, and teams stop reading the dashboard. The right mix should include at least three performance metrics, three cost and efficiency metrics, and four failure or exception metrics. That balance gives leadership a clear view of both customer experience and margin pressure.
For many teams, the dashboard can live in a spreadsheet with simple charts and conditional formatting. The objective is not sophistication for its own sake. It is actionability. If a KPI is not being reviewed by operations, customer service, or finance in a weekly meeting, it probably does not belong in the core dashboard.
Step 3: Add segmentation that changes decisions
Every useful KPI should be viewable by carrier, service level, shipping zone, warehouse, channel, and product family if possible. Segmentation turns a flat number into a decision tool. For example, a 96% on-time rate across all shipments may hide a 90% rate for one carrier in zone 8. Without segmentation, you may keep paying for a weak service because the overall average looks acceptable.
Keep the dashboard simple, but not simplistic. A small business can still use meaningful slices without needing enterprise BI. The best practice is to start broad, then drill into the two or three segments that move the needle most. This is where practical analytics beats vanity reporting.
Weekly KPI Review Workflow for SMB Operations Teams
Monday: review the scorecard
Schedule one recurring weekly meeting with operations, customer service, and if possible finance. Begin with the KPI summary and highlight variances from the prior week and the four-week average. The goal is to identify where the process changed, not to recite numbers. If the team cannot explain a swing in performance, assign an owner to investigate the driver before the next meeting.
Keep the meeting short and structured. Five minutes on cost, five on speed, five on failures, and five on actions is often enough. What matters is consistency. A weekly cadence creates accountability and prevents performance problems from hiding in a backlog of spreadsheets and email threads.
Tuesday to Thursday: fix the outliers
Once the review is complete, the team should work on the highest-impact issues first. If cost per shipment rose because of packaging, test a smaller carton or different void fill. If order accuracy dipped, audit the pick path and the SKU mix that generated errors. If delivery exceptions increased, escalate the problem to the carrier and inspect address quality or label timing.
This is where operations metrics become useful in a commercial sense. The KPI is not the finish line; it is the trigger for an action. Small businesses that build this habit usually see improvements faster than businesses that only inspect monthly summary reports.
Friday: update the playbook
Every week should end with a small process improvement or a documented decision. Maybe you changed the default service for one region, improved packing standards, or added an address check at checkout. Capture the change so next week’s results can be interpreted correctly. Without this step, you will know the number changed but not why.
Over time, your dashboard becomes a living operations manual. That is especially helpful for growing SMBs where responsibilities shift and staff turnover creates knowledge gaps. The best dashboards do more than report performance; they preserve operational memory.
Comparison Table: KPI, Why It Matters, and Typical Actions
| KPI | What It Tells You | Typical SMB Action | Best Segments | Review Frequency |
|---|---|---|---|---|
| Cost per shipment | Shipping margin pressure | Right-size packaging, renegotiate service mix | Carrier, zone, package type | Weekly |
| On-time delivery rate | Promise reliability | Adjust carrier allocation or promised dates | Carrier, service level, region | Weekly |
| Order accuracy rate | Pick-pack quality | Audit workflows, improve inventory sync | Warehouse, SKU, channel | Weekly |
| Average transit time | Actual shipping speed | Re-route lanes or change service tiers | Zone, carrier, origin | Weekly |
| Delivery exception rate | Failure frequency | Fix address validation or carrier issues | Exception type, carrier | Weekly |
This table is intentionally compact so it can be pasted into a weekly dashboard template or used as the backbone of an operations review. The broader principle is that every KPI should lead to a specific action, not just a discussion. If a metric never changes decisions, remove it.
Benchmarks, Trends, and What Good Looks Like
Use your own trend line before chasing industry averages
There is no universal “good” shipping number for every SMB because product type, geography, and customer promise all change the target. A company shipping low-value accessories should not benchmark itself against a fragile luxury goods brand. Your first benchmark should be your own four-week and twelve-week trend lines. That tells you whether operations are improving or deteriorating.

What signals usually indicate a problem
Three warning signs come up repeatedly in SMB logistics: cost rises without volume growth, delivery speed worsens while carrier mix stays the same, and exception rates rise before customer complaints do. When these show up together, you likely have a process issue rather than a seasonal one. That could mean a new packaging configuration, delayed handoff, inaccurate inventory counts, or a carrier service problem.
Use the weekly dashboard to catch those shifts early. The sooner a problem is identified, the cheaper it is to correct. A two-week delay in noticing a broken fulfillment process can lead to hundreds of affected shipments, whereas a one-week anomaly may only require a small fix.
How to translate metrics into margin
Every shipping KPI should eventually connect to one of three outcomes: lower cost, faster delivery, or fewer failures. Cost per shipment impacts gross margin directly. On-time delivery and transit time affect repeat purchase behavior. Order accuracy and exception rate affect refunds, reships, and support cost. That is why shipment analytics is not just an operations exercise; it is a revenue protection system.
Small businesses that treat these metrics seriously often uncover “leakage” that would never appear in a standard P&L. A small increase in label errors, for instance, can create support costs that dwarf the original shipping expense. A modest reduction in late deliveries can improve reviews and reduce churn. That is the practical payoff of weekly visibility.
Templates, Alerts, and a Simple KPI Operating Model
Weekly dashboard template structure
A useful SMB dashboard can fit on one page. Top row: headline KPIs with current week, prior week, and four-week average. Middle row: carrier and service-level performance by segment. Bottom row: exceptions, root causes, and action items with owners and due dates. This format ensures executives can scan the summary while operators can drill into the reasons behind the numbers.
Use color sparingly. Red should mean a meaningful breach, not simply a bad day. Yellow should indicate a trend that needs watching. Green should confirm performance in range. Too many colors reduce clarity and make the dashboard feel like a report instead of a decision tool.
Alerts that are actually useful
Not every KPI needs a real-time alert. In fact, too many alerts create fatigue and cause teams to ignore important issues. For SMBs, the best alerts are threshold-based: cost per shipment above target by X%, on-time delivery below target for two weeks, or exception rate above a defined level in one carrier lane. Keep alerts aligned to decisions, not data availability.
If your team uses automated notifications, make sure they are connected to a response playbook. An alert without an owner or action is just noise. The most effective teams route alerts to the person who can fix the problem fastest, whether that is the warehouse lead, carrier manager, or customer experience manager.
When to upgrade from spreadsheet to software
Most SMBs can start with a spreadsheet-based weekly dashboard. Upgrade when manual reconciliation starts taking too long, when data from multiple channels becomes hard to normalize, or when executives need more frequent visibility than one person can maintain. At that point, a shipping analytics tool or BI-lite platform may be worthwhile. The goal is not to become enterprise-like; it is to remove friction as the business grows.

Common Mistakes SMBs Make With Shipping Analytics
Tracking too many metrics
The most common mistake is trying to measure everything at once. That creates dashboard clutter and distracts teams from the most important levers. A concise set of ten KPIs is enough for most businesses, especially if each one has a clear owner and action. Adding more metrics should only happen after the core scorecard is stable and used consistently.
Another issue is measuring metrics that no one can influence. If a KPI cannot be improved by your operations team, it should probably live in an occasional executive report, not the weekly dashboard. A good dashboard is opinionated and practical.
Ignoring data quality
Shipping analytics is only as reliable as the data feeding it. Missing scans, inconsistent carrier codes, duplicate orders, and incorrect dispatch timestamps can all distort results. Small businesses often blame carriers for bad numbers when the underlying issue is internal data hygiene. Make data validation part of the KPI process itself.
A simple weekly audit can prevent a lot of confusion. Compare a small sample of shipped orders against carrier records to confirm timestamps and statuses. If the data is broken, fix the extraction logic before drawing conclusions from the chart.
Failing to assign owners
Metrics without ownership rarely improve. Every KPI should have a responsible owner and a clear escalation path. Cost per shipment may sit with operations or finance, while order accuracy belongs to fulfillment, and on-time delivery may require both carrier management and customer service coordination. Ownership turns a report into an operating system.
Once owners are assigned, track the corrective action just as closely as the KPI itself. If the same problem appears for three weeks in a row, the issue is usually not the metric; it is the lack of follow-through.

FAQ: Shipment Analytics for Small Businesses
1) How many shipment KPIs should a small business track weekly?
Most SMBs should track 8 to 10 core KPIs. That is enough to monitor cost, speed, and failures without creating dashboard overload. Add more only when a metric clearly changes decisions.
2) What is the most important shipment KPI?
Cost per shipment is usually the most important for margin control, but on-time delivery rate is often the best customer experience indicator. In practice, the most useful dashboard includes both.
3) Should I track carrier performance or overall shipping performance?
Both, but start with overall performance and then segment by carrier, service level, and zone. Carrier-level analysis is what tells you where the problem lives.
4) Do I need a BI tool for shipping analytics?
No. Many SMBs can run a reliable weekly dashboard in a spreadsheet or lightweight reporting tool. Upgrade to software when manual reporting becomes too time-consuming or error-prone.
5) How do I improve order accuracy quickly?
Start by auditing your top error types, then fix the process that causes them. In many cases that means improving inventory sync, tightening pick-pack checks, and validating addresses earlier in the order flow.
6) What should I do if delivery exceptions suddenly spike?
Break the exceptions into categories such as bad address, weather, damage, and scan issues. Then compare the spike against carrier, zone, and dispatch timing to find the root cause.
